## Sensor drift: what to do at 3am

If the GrowLoop controller starts reporting humidity swings that don't match the backup probes in the Fernwick greenhouse, it's almost always sensor drift, not an actual climate event. Don't panic and don't touch the vents manually. First, restart the calibration daemon and give it ten minutes to re-baseline. If readings still disagree by more than 5%, flip the controller into safe mode. The safe-mode thresholds it will use are these.

config for yahap-bajof:
[istix]
host = istix.qorvelsys.internal
user = istix_svc
database = istix_prod

Handover Note — From Director Aldren Pike to Director Sela Marchetti, copied to branch managers. The second-source supplier search for the Vantrel housing components is midway through evaluation. Three candidates remain: Ostberg Fabrication, Quillane Metals, and Drossel Works. Sample testing finishes in three weeks; cost comparisons are drafted but unverified. Please continue weekly check-ins with procurement. The rationale driving this search is set out in the confidential note below.

internal memo for tajof-kaduf: Only 65 of the 511 pilot accounts renewed Lamdor, so a churn review is set for January 26. Aldmirek Works is in early talks to buy Alddorox Works for about $490.9 million.

CI Troubleshooting — Gridmere Export Runner

Plugin authors: if your export plugin fails the memory gate, the usual cause is retaining full sheet snapshots between chunk flushes. The Gridmere runner enforces a 512 MB ceiling per export job; streaming writers stay well under it. Reproduce locally with the harness before filing. The gate was last calibrated against the build identified below.

build token for tahop-fafof: htk14_2d55df8101eccc

## TICKET-4417: Signature check failing on bounce processor artifacts

The Mailhollow bounce processor is rejecting its own deploy artifacts with `SIG_MISMATCH` since last night's rotation. Bounce events are queuing in the Driftbin spool; nothing is lost yet, but capacity runs out in roughly six hours. The old verification key was revoked early — before the new artifacts finished propagating. To unblock, update the verifier config with the replacement key below.

deploy key for kajof-fajop: bky6_gDHw9Q